Understanding the Mechanics of the Ascent

At its heart, the game operates on a provably fair random number generator (RNG). This means that the outcome of each round is determined by a cryptographic algorithm, ensuring transparency and eliminating any suspicion of manipulation. Players can independently verify the fairness of each game, adding a layer of trust that’s often missing in the online gambling world. The RNG determines when the plane will “crash,” ending the round and potentially forfeiting players' bets. Different platforms may use slightly different algorithms, but the core principle of provable fairness remains constant. Understanding this feature is essential for building confidence and appreciating the integrity of the gameplay experience.

The multiplier, which steadily increases during the flight, is directly linked to the time the airplane remains airborne. A longer flight translates into a higher multiplier, and therefore a greater potential payout. The rate at which the multiplier increases isn't constant; it often accelerates as the flight progresses, further amplifying the risk-reward dynamic. Players need to be acutely aware of this increasing rate, as it influences the optimal timing for cashing out. Many experienced players employ strategies based on observing patterns in multiplier growth, though it’s crucial to remember that each round is fundamentally independent.

Strategies for Managing Risk and Reward

While the game is based on chance, certain strategies can improve your odds of success and minimize potential losses. One popular approach is the Martingale system, which involves doubling your bet after each loss, hoping to recover previous losses with a single win. However, this strategy requires a substantial bankroll and carries the risk of significant losses if a losing streak persists. Another tactic is to set predetermined profit targets and stop-loss limits. This helps maintain discipline and prevents emotional decision-making. Setting a realistic profit target encourages you to cash out when you're ahead, while a stop-loss limit protects you from losing more than you can afford. Remember, responsible gambling is paramount.

Beyond these basic strategies, some players utilize more advanced techniques, such as observing historical data to identify potential patterns in the RNG’s behavior. However, it's essential to approach these techniques with caution, as past performance is not necessarily indicative of future results. The game is designed to be unpredictable, and attempting to “beat” the system is often a futile exercise. The most effective approach is to focus on managing your risk, setting realistic goals, and enjoying the thrill of the game responsibly.

The Psychology of the Aviator Experience

The appeal of the aviator game extends beyond its simple mechanics and potential for financial reward. It taps into fundamental psychological principles that contribute to its addictive nature. The escalating multiplier creates a sense of anticipation and excitement, triggering the release of dopamine in the brain – a neurotransmitter associated with pleasure and reward. This dopamine rush reinforces the desire to continue playing, hoping for the next big win. The near-miss effect, where the plane almost crashes before soaring to new heights, also plays a role, fueling the belief that a substantial payout is just around the corner. This is similar to the psychological principles that govern slot machine addiction.

The fast-paced nature of the game and its visually appealing interface further contribute to its engaging qualities. Each round is relatively quick, providing a constant stream of stimulation and preventing boredom. The airplane graphic and the dynamic backdrop create a visually immersive experience that draws players into the game world. This heightened sensory engagement amplifies the emotional impact of wins and losses, making the game even more captivating. The social aspect, often integrated into online platforms through chat features, also enhances the overall experience, fostering a sense of community and competition.

Assessing Your Bankroll and Bet Sizing

Your bankroll – the total amount of money you've allocated for gambling – is a critical factor in determining your bet size. A general rule of thumb is to bet no more than 1-5% of your bankroll on any single round. This helps protect you from significant losses and extends your playing time. Adjust your bet size based on your risk tolerance and your chosen strategy. If you're employing a conservative strategy, you can afford to bet a smaller percentage of your bankroll. If you're willing to take on more risk, you can increase your bet size accordingly, but be mindful of the potential consequences.

Beyond the Flight: Responsible Gaming and Community Support

While the excitement of the aviator game is undeniable, it’s imperative to prioritize responsible gaming practices. Setting time limits, managing your bankroll effectively, and avoiding chasing losses are all crucial steps. Recognize the signs of problematic gambling behavior, such as spending more time and money on the game than you intended, neglecting personal responsibilities, or experiencing emotional distress due to gambling losses. If you suspect you may have a gambling problem, reach out for help. Numerous resources are available to provide support and guidance.
